引言
在当今技术飞速发展的时代,跨平台编程成为了软件开发的一个重要趋势。它允许开发者使用单一代码库来创建适用于多种操作系统和设备的软件。本文将为您提供一系列的教程和书籍指南,帮助您掌握跨平台编程技能。
跨平台编程简介
什么是跨平台编程?
跨平台编程是指使用一种编程语言和工具,开发出可以在不同操作系统和设备上运行的软件。这种开发方式可以显著提高开发效率,降低成本。
跨平台编程的优势
- 提高开发效率:使用单一代码库,可以减少重复工作。
- 降低成本:无需为每个平台编写不同的代码。
- 更好的用户体验:软件可以在多个平台上提供一致的用户体验。
必备教程
1. Flutter教程
Flutter是由Google开发的一款流行的跨平台UI框架,用于构建美观、高性能的移动应用。
- 官方文档:Flutter官方文档
- 入门教程:Flutter入门教程
- 实战项目:Flutter实战项目教程
2. React Native教程
React Native是由Facebook开发的一款跨平台移动应用框架,允许开发者使用JavaScript和React编写原生应用。
- 官方文档:React Native官方文档
- 入门教程:React Native入门教程
- 实战项目:React Native实战项目教程
3. Xamarin教程
Xamarin是由Microsoft开发的一款跨平台开发框架,允许开发者使用C#和.NET编写应用。
- 官方文档:Xamarin官方文档
- 入门教程:Xamarin入门教程
- 实战项目:Xamarin实战项目教程
必备书籍
1. 《Flutter实战》
本书详细介绍了Flutter框架的使用,包括UI设计、动画、网络请求等。
- 作者:王赛
- 出版社:电子工业出版社
2. 《React Native实战》
本书通过实例讲解了React Native框架的使用,包括组件开发、状态管理、网络请求等。
- 作者:陈浩
- 出版社:人民邮电出版社
3. 《Xamarin开发实战》
本书介绍了Xamarin框架的使用,包括UI设计、数据绑定、网络请求等。
- 作者:王磊
- 出版社:机械工业出版社
总结
掌握跨平台编程技能对于软件开发者来说至关重要。通过本文提供的教程和书籍指南,您可以快速入门并掌握跨平台编程技术。祝您在跨平台开发的道路上越走越远!
